Dan Duminy Taps Nasty C For “Let Me Down” Song & Video – Watch

If you have missed something from Dan Duminy for a while, you are in for something refreshing as the songster premieres a new tune titled “Let Me Down” in collaboration with his pal Nasty C. Not only did Dan drop the audio, but he also released the visuals for it as well.

So, if you’re more into videos, there’s something for you as well, and we expect you would have a wonderful time vibing with it.

Dan Duminy is a pal to Nasty C and the two happen to have great musical synergy, which means that listening to them together is more than a pleasure. You might end up hankering to see them together. Not Bad.

The two artists are pretty young, with Nasty C seemingly the one most in the news. The “Zulu Man With Some Power” had signed a deal with Def Jam Africa which facilitated his move to the United States, where he expected to expand his hip-hop career and reach.

Since then, he has been flying between the Rainbow Nation and Uncle Sam.
